libauditd: make it a PRIVATELIB
According to the upstream man page (which we don't install), none of libauditd's symbols are intended to be public. Also, I can't find any evidence for a port that uses libauditd. Therefore, we should treat it like other such libraries and use PRIVATELIB.

pkgbase: Create a FreeBSD-utilities package and make it the default one
The default package use to be FreeBSD-runtime but it should only contain binaries and libs enough to boot to single user and repair the system, it is also very handy to have a package that can be tranform to a small mfsroot. So create a new package named FreeBSD-utilities and make it the default one. Also move a few binaries and lib into this package when it make sense.
